The Commodities Markets Oversight Coalition has urged four Republican members of the House of Representatives’ Committee on Financial Services to push for position limits in commodities, saying the curbs are “vital for proper functioning” of the markets, despite a court ruling that overturned the Commodity Futures Trading Commission’s effort to impose such limits.

The net notional outstanding of European Union sovereign credit default swaps has plunged to roughly 112 billion, its lowest level since records of the activity began, as the Nov. 1 effective a E.U. ban on naked CDS approaches.

Credit default swaps on German sovereign debt has narrowed to its lowest level since October 2010 on optimism that the European Central Bank will help ailing banks in Europe.
